Comparison: Butter London Tart With a Heart vs. Nina Holographic Topcoat

Here's a quick post comparing Butter London Tart With a Heart with Nina Holographic Topcoat. I had a hard time finding Tart With a Heart at the sample counters at my local Nordstroms, and then only got a few pictures before the polish peeled off my nail wheel. As you can see, the Nina Holographic Topcoat is very close to Tart With a Heart, but it's not an exact dupe.

In MissCarley's pictures, Nina Holographic topcoat is on the left and TwaH is on the right. She tried it over American Apparel Hassid (a black creme) and Butter London The Black Knight.  

I hope you can see in these pictures that the concentration of microglitter in TwaH is a little denser than the Nina Holographic topcoat. However, the polishes are so similar that I think Nina Holographic Topcoat will be close enough for those of you lemming Butter London Tart With a Heart.
